WebJul 6, 2015 · Bloom Booster – Fertilizer Nonsense #5. Bloom Boosters are said to increase the number of flowers on your plant. Nonsense. They don’t work, and can actually make your soil toxic, making it more difficult for your plants to grow. Bloom booster fertilizer – who needs it? If you let your plant get to the point of the foliage wilting, you will often see some flower buds fall off before opening. 2. Potting mix staying too wet. Never let your plant sit in water and stay sopping wet for extended periods.
